Should You Give Your Pet CBD?

Bella Breakdown

As marijuana becomes increasingly legalized in the United States, CBD oil has also become much more popular. To clarify, CBD is not the chemical that makes people high (that is THC). People generally use CBD oil to help with aches and pains, such as chronic arthritis.

Surprisingly, dog owners have also been turning to CBD as of late. If you go into a marijuana store, you will now see sections specifically for your pets. Owners most often use CBD when their dogs show symptoms of anxiety, stress, or arthritis.

If your dog is exhibiting signs of separation anxiety, such as destroying things when you leave the house or becoming very nervous when you grab your keys and put on your coat, then you may want to consider if CBD is a good option to help calm down your dog.

Likewise, CBD can help older dogs that are experiencing chronic joint pain, just as it helps humans with arthritis. If you notice that your dog is often in pain after exercise, then be sure to check with your vet. They may recommend CBD as a potential solution.

However, it should be noted that although some veterinarians have heard success stories from their clients, they are often hesitant to suggest that owners use CBD on their animals because there is not a lot of research out there to back up the supposed benefits.
